How it works

From install to live in about three days

1

Install the plugin

Gennoctua installs into your existing site or app as a lightweight plugin — no bulky SDK, no rebuild.

2

Shopper opts in and captures an image

Consent and image capture happen directly inside the plugin, at the point of use — nothing is collected upstream.

3

Gennoctua renders and scores it

The shopper sees themselves in the product, alongside a Style, Fit & Match verdict grounded in their actual body or space.

4

The result stays with the shopper

The personalized render is cached on the shopper's own device — not retained on Gennoctua's or the retailer's servers.

How Gennoctua actually handles a shopper's image

Consent and image capture happen directly inside the plugin, at the point of use. Generation is cloud-assisted today — on-device generation isn't yet mature enough to run at production quality, so we're honest about that rather than claim otherwise. The result is cached on the shopper's own device, not retained on Gennoctua's or the retailer's servers, and each install captures fresh rather than sharing an identity across apps.

What is virtual try-on software?

Virtual try-on software lets a shopper see a product on themselves or in their own space before buying, instead of relying on a model or a generic product photo.

Which product categories does Gennoctua's try-on cover?

Apparel & footwear; eyewear, jewelry & bags; and furniture & décor — across a shopper's complete catalog, not a single flagship category.

Does virtual try-on reduce returns?

Gennoctua doesn't publish its own verified return-rate figures yet, so we won't quote a number we can't back up. The mechanism — confirming fit and style before checkout via Style, Fit & Match — is built specifically to address the fit-uncertainty that drives returns.

Is this a plugin or an SDK?

A plugin. That's a deliberate choice for a faster, lower-friction install than a traditional SDK requires — typically about three days.
